What is a furlough ?

Furlongs are mandatory temporary time off from work, with no pay. It can be an unpaid leave of absence, pay cut or reduction in working hours, etc. It is being used as a strategy to keep employees on staff with an aim to protect the company’s bottom line.

All organizations are forced to make difficult decisions like furloughs or layoffs when facing financial hardship.

The main objective of furlough is to cut down costs while keeping your employees employed; it may be either to shift funds in the other business processes or avoid critical spending during times of hardships.

In furloughs, employees do not receive their pay, and they often get their health benefits and life insurance. Furlough employees can apply for unemployment, but the laws for furloughing employees may vary from state to state, so employees should ensure this with the company’s legal counsel before applying for unemployment.

The main difference between furloughs and layoffs is that furloughed employees have a job that will resume shortly, but laid-off employees, brought back to the same position is less likely to happen.

Why might employers place employees on furlough ?

Though some furloughs are planned due to seasonal downtimes in business, some others may be due to financial instability.

For instance, companies in tourist destinations are busy only during certain times of the year and are shut down during other times of the year. So they may require employees only for this time of the year and not during the off-seasons.

Other reasons may lead to a furlough like recessions, pandemic, etc. These factors may force a business to slow or cease activity for a certain period temporarily.

Advantages and disadvantages of employee furloughs

Ideally, no employee wants to be out of work; still, furloughs can be helpful to employees and employers in certain circumstances.

Advantages of employee furloughs

1. Avoid layoffs

The significant benefit of furlough is that the employees have the assurance that they will or may have jobs in the future, though they are not receiving paychecks during this time. If the employees know that their furloughs are for a short period, they can provide some comfort level.

2. Save compensation costs

For employers, employee furlough helps to reduce labor costs due to a decrease in paid salaries. Moreover, employee furloughs need not cover early retirement benefits, outplacement, severance, etc.

3. Retain talent pool

Employee furlough helps to have a talent pool in hand for the employers. This helps to reduce the time for hiring and training new employees. Managers can count on these talented hands when required. Employees will also be ready to accept the offer rather than losing their job altogether.

4. Allows planning

The seasonal business may need the employees only during certain times of the year. And when both sides are aware of this, employees can plan and use the other time for something useful.

5. Tweak business processes

Employee furlough help employer to rebrand and recognize their business operations. It helps them to have a stable workforce and generate more revenue.

Disadvantages of employee furloughs

Though there are advantages for employee furlough, there are many disadvantages also.

1. Job searching

Furlough leaves may not be pleasant for all employees, especially those depending on a regular paycheck. So employees may start searching for other jobs, and the employers may lose the talented heads from the pool.

2. Lower performance

As the furloughed employee may return to the same workload after many days, they may feel overloaded. There are chances for this to affect the work quality.

3. Re-opening takes time

Usually, it may take time for the employees to get back to work and run things like before. They will need some time to return with the same efficiency; if new employees are hired, they may need time to train them.

4. Unsatisfied customers

Customer experience may affect due to employee furlough. Customers might face longer waiting times or lack experienced hands to deal with specific situations.

5. A decline in company morale

Employee furlough may affect the company morale. It can cause a sense of insecurity in other employees, which may eventually affect performance, loyalty, commitment, etc. Employees tend to be insecure about their future.

Tips for a successful furlough notice

Make use of these tips to implement a furlough successfully:

1. Establish credibility

Have a senior executive or CEO deliver the furlough notice to the employees.

2. Define furlough leave

Explain furlough leave to your employees clearly. Do not think they are aware of this already.

3. Provide security

Explain clearly how furlough will affect the employee benefits, what it means to employees, and how this decision will affect their future with the company.

4. Clear doubts

Give your employees a chance to clear their doubts, talk to them and help them to express their concerns openly.

To sum up

Though it is difficult for employees to stay out of work, employee furloughs are beneficial for the employees and employers at times. Employees can plan the furlough leave productively.

Furlough leaves, when implemented successfully by the employer with a well-defined road map, can turn out to be one of the powerful business tools.
